<p/><br></br><p><b> Book Synopsis </b></p></br></br><p>Mark Hunter LaVigne, best-selling author of The Broken Ukulele, returns with another tale of adventure in Ontario's Algonquin Park. Mark, best friend Larry, and a troup of family members embark on a canoe trip in search of the spirit of famous painter Tom Thomson -- not to mention his ghost -- and a "broken" turtle first encountered on a canoe trip many years earlier. Along the way they encounter wind, rain, and lightning, leeches, earworms, the aforementioned turtle, and many memories of canoe trips past. The result is a tale at once humorous, charming, and heartwarming.</p>
